About Sherwin-Williams Celestial
Celestial sits in the mid-range at LRV 44, so it shifts visibly through the day — lighter and more open in morning light, deeper and moodier after dark. Its blue und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. South-facing rooms will pull it lighter and warmer, while north light cools it down.
Celestial is versatile enough for full rooms but has enough depth to anchor a space, so it suits living rooms, bedrooms and cabinetry alike. Blues calm a room, which makes them popular in bedrooms, bathrooms and home offices.

Sherwin-Williams Celestial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Celestial from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Sherwin-Williams SW 6808 direct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Behr Equivalent of Celestial
Behr's nearest match is Blue Suede (PPU14-10),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.12).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 45 vs 44) and carries a cool blue undertone, so it substitutes for Celestial without repainting risk. See the full Blue Suede swatch →
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Celestial
At Benjamin Moore, the closest color to Celestial is Riviera Azure (822) — very close at ΔE 2.58,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 45 vs 44) and carries a cool blue und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Riviera Azure swatch →
Valspar Equivalent of Celestial
Valspar's nearest match is Moonglow (8002-45C),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.12). It runs slightly darker (LRV 42 vs 44) and carries a cool blue undertone, so it substitutes for Celestial without repainting risk. See the full Moonglow swatch →
